Desired by Elisire is an oriental floral fragrance for men and women. Launched in 2017, this composition was created by Philippine Courtière. The top notes unfold with saffron, clove, cumin, and bergamot; the heart reveals sandalwood, Atlas cedar, Virginia cedar, sambac jasmine, and carnation; while the base notes settle on bourbon vanilla, oud wood, guaiac wood, amber, tonka bean, patchouli, and labdanum.

  • Honestly, I loved this perfume. It’s a very delicate and balanced rose with oud. It has an air of Lancôme’s Oud Bouquet and similar scents, but with less sweetness, making it easier to wear, even in warm springs. The sillage is moderate and the longevity on my skin is about 10 hours, with the last 2-3 fading to skin scent. That said, despite liking it so much, the 160 euros for 30 ml seem outrageous, so I won’t buy it. Scent 8.5/10, Longevity 10/10, Sillage 7/10, Value 2/10, Versatility 7/10, Packaging 8/10. Would I buy it again? No, I didn’t.

  • Alchemy of Desire, Fever for the Divine, and a golden sunbath. Majestic rose, jasmine, carnation, cumin, clove, and saffron blend into a golden flower… Did someone say vanilla? Desired is exactly that: an overdose of familiar vanillin, Cashmeran, and hints of gallic and cedar. Nothing fresh, just boring and overused. It tries to stand out with cumin at the start, but it ends up shrill and too artificial. It’s aggressive on the skin, and the other notes give it a sharp character that doesn’t appeal. As for the oud and roses… I’m surprised they claim to be the heart. My nose doesn’t even pick them up. This Desired doesn’t awaken any desire. A completely forgettable fragrance. Cheers.
